Top 5 courses after BCom abroad

Some of the top courses that one can pursue after BCom from abroad are listed below:

Masters in Business Administration

Some countries have better business schools than others, but the following countries have been chosen based on their reputation and quality of education: Canada, Ireland, Australia, New Zealand. Canada has a very strong reputation for its education system and it also has an international network of universities and colleges with a diverse range of programs for students from all over the world. Ireland’s education system is one of the best in Europe and it provides students with an excellent opportunity for international experience. Australia’s MBA program offers an excellent global perspective on business concepts as well as access to international networks at a competitive cost. New Zealand's MBA program has been recognized by some of the most prestigious universities in the world.

Graduates in commerce can choose from specialties in finance, human resources, accounting, investment banking, marketing, and international business for their postgraduate work. B-schools in the United States, United Kingdom, Canada, Australia, and Germany maintain top global rankings. For courses after a BCom, Indian students must take a variety of competitive tests, including the GMAT, GRE, IELTS, and TOEFL.

Masters of Commerce 

Many people are of the opinion that studying abroad is a costly affair. However, if you have a Masters in Commerce from abroad, you can leverage your skillset to get work in the country. It is important to note that international students should not be discouraged by the cost associated with studying abroad. There are many scholarships available for international students who study at reputable universities and put forth good performances during their studies. After finishing a three-year full-time BCom degree, students can pursue a 2-year Master of Commerce programme at overseas universities. Accounting, economics, statistics, sciences, and finance are all covered in the course. The Mcom degree opens up a wide range of job options. Opportunities for work in banking, insurance, research, finance, and accounting are available to students.

Masters in Business Analytics 

The Masters in Business Analytics program from abroad offers an opportunity for international students who want to work in the foreign market. The program has been created with a focus on developing analytical skills that can be applied across industries and sectors. The need for knowledgeable business analytics specialists is rising quickly abroad as a result of increased digitization. Data analyst, business analyst, quantitative analyst, and risk analyst are the available professions.

Masters in Finance 

Leading international colleges also demand two years of work experience in the banking industry as a prerequisite for admission. Following completion of a master's degree, employment options include investment banking, corporate banking, financial analyst, financial consulting, financial adviser, and stockbroker.







Masters in Economics 

A Master in Economics from abroad is a degree that provides the skills needed to analyze and understand the economic challenges of today. It is not only important for students to have an understanding of the economic principles, but also to be able to apply them in their career. A degree which offers both theoretical and practical experience is a great asset for students who want to enter this highly competitive field. After graduation, foreign colleges in the USA and UK offer specialist degrees in economics. Indian students can get job as a budget analyst, financial analyst, operations analyst, and list and market analyst after earning a master's degree in economics.

Q. Which country is best after BCom?

A. Some of the best countries to pursue your education after attaining a BCom degree are the United States, United Kingdom, Canada, Australia, and Germany as most of the top B-schools are based in these nations.

Q. Can I get a job in abroad after BCom?

A. Securing a job abroad after a BCom degree is a bit difficult as a lot of factors are involved in the procedure. You must have at least a few years of experience in order to get a job. However, a few countries like Canada have good job opportunities for BCom graduates.
